Sb ion SUBJECT: Notice of Violation and Assessment of Civil Penalty for Violations of North Carolina General Statute (G.S.) 143-215.1(a)(6)" and NPDES WW" Permit No. NC0028606 NC DOT - Environmental Operations I-77 Rest Area Iredell County Case No. LV -2016-0205 lredell County Dear Mr. Joyce: This letter transmits a Notice of Violation and assessment of civil penalty in the amount'of $551.00.($450.00 civil penalty + $101.00 enforcement costs) against NC DOT =Environmental Operations. This assessment is based upon the following facts: a review has been conducted of the discharge monitoring report (DMR) submitted by NC DOT - Environmental Operations for the month of May 2016.. This review.has shown the subject facility to be in violation of the discharge limitations and/or monitoring'requirements found in NPDES WW Permit No.:NC0028606. The violations, which occurred in May 2016, -are summarized in Attachment A to this letter. Based upon the above facts, I conclude as a matter of law that NC DOT - Environmental Operations violated the terms, conditions -or requirements of,NPDES=WW Permit No: NC0028606 and G.S::143 215.1(a)(6) in'the-manner and extent.. shown in Attachment A. In accordance with the.maximums established by G.S. 143-215..6A(a)(2), a civil -penalty may be assessed against any person who violates the terms, conditions or requirements of a -permit required by G.S. 443=215J(a). Permit Daily Maximum for TSS - Conc. 250.00 1 of the 1 violations of '143-215.l(a)(6) and Permit No.N00028606; by discharging wastewater into the waters of the State in violation of the Permit Monthly Average for BOD - Conc.. . 450.00 TOTAL CIVIL PENALTY . 101.00 Enforcement Costs 551.00 TOTAL AMOUNT DUE- Pursuant to G.S. 143-215.6A(c), in determining the amount of the penalty I have taken into account the Findings of Fact and Conclusions of Law and the factors set forth at G.S. 143B-282.1(b), which are: (1) The degree and extent of harm to the natural resources ofthe State, to the public health, or to private property . resulting from the violation; (2) The, duration and gravity of the violation; (3) The effect on� ground or surface water quantity or quality or on air quality;. . (4) The cost of rectifying. the -damage; (5) The amount of money saved by noncompliance; (6) Whether the violation was committed willfully or intentionally; (1) The prior record of the violator in complying or failing to comply with programs over which the Environmental Management Commission has regulatory authority; and (8) The cost to the State of the enforcement procedures.. Please submit payment to the attention of: Wastewater Branch Division"of Water Resource s 161Z:Mai1.,Ser ice Center Raleigh, North Carolina 27699-1617 N v a } Option 2: Submit a written request for remission or,mitigation including a detailed justification for such, .. request: Please be aware that a request for remission is limited -to -consideration of the five factors listed below as they may relate to the reasonableness of the'amountof the civil penalty assessed: Requesting remission is not the proper procedure for contesting whether the violation(s) :occurred or the accuracy of'any of the factual statements contained in the civil penalty assessment document. 'BecauseA remission request forecloses the option'of an'administrative hearing, such a request mustbe accompanied by a waiver of your right to an administrative hearing and a stipulation'. agreement that no,factual or legal issues are in dispute. Please prep are'a detailed statemeint that establishes why you believe the civil penalty -should be. remitted, and submit,itto the Division of Water Resources at the address listed below. In determining whether a remission request will be approved, the following factors shall be considered: (1) whether one or more of the civil penalty assessment factors in NCGS 143B -282.1(b) was wrongfully applied to the detriment of the petitioner; (2)whether the violator promptly "abated continuingenvironmental damage resulting from the. violation; . (3) whether the violation was inadvertent or a result of an accident; . (4) whether the violator had been assessed civil penalties for any previous violations; or (5) whether payment of the civil penalty will prevent payment for the remaining necessary remedial actions. Please note that all evidence presented in support of your request for remission must be submitted in writing. 'The .Director of the Division of Water Resources will review your evidence and inform you of his decision in the matter of your remission request. The response will provide details regarding the case status, directions for payment, and provision for further appeal of the penalty to the Environmental Management Commission's Committee on Civil Penalty Remissions (Committee). Please be advised that the Committee cannot consider information that was not part of the original remission request considered by the Director:. °Therefore,'it is very.important that you prepare a complete and thorough statement in support of your request for remission. Please be aware that a request for remission is limited to consideration of the five factors listed below as they may relate to the reasonableness of the amount of the civil penalty assessed. Requesting remission is not the proper procedure for contesting whether the violation(s) occurred or the accuracy of any of the factual statements contained in the civil penalty assessment document. Pursuant to N.C.G.S. § 143B -282.1(c), remission of a civil, penalty may be granted only when one or more of the following five factors apply. Please check each factor that you believe applies to your case andprovide a detailed explanation, including copies of supporting documents, as to why the factor applies (attach additional' pages as needed). (a) one or more of the civil penalty assessment factors in N.C.G.S. 143B -282.1(b) were wrongfully applied to the detriment of the petitioner (the assessment factors are listed in the civil penalty assessment document); (b) the violator promptly abated continuing environmental damage resulting from the violation (i.e., explain the steps that you took to correct the violation and prevent future occurrences); (c) the violation was inadvertent or a result of an accident (i. e., explain why the violation was unavoidable or something you could not prevent or prepare for); (d) the violator had not been assessed civil penalties for any previous violations; (e) payment of the civil penalty will prevent payment for the remaining necessary remedial actions (i.e., explain how payment of the civil penalty will prevent you from performing the activities necessary to achieve compliance).
